Transaction 81afb2d6365d8bdae89d76493631bb713622c5dc71ac447af2aceead1dc1120b

2 Input
2 Outputs
  • 81afb2d6365d8bdae89d76493631bb713622c5dc71ac447af2aceead1dc1120b:0
  • value  250000
    address  3G9P18hfa3V6W68kk62NpoGc3HVZx2hSB9
  • 81afb2d6365d8bdae89d76493631bb713622c5dc71ac447af2aceead1dc1120b:1
  • value  1006748
    address  376QLYSW8WigBpK2C8eSZsV4oKHtiatkPU